LAHORE (Dunya News) - Jamaat-e-Islami (JI) Ameer Hafiz Naeem-ur-Rehman has said the current system is not giving people the right to live.

In a statement issued here on Wednesday, the JI chief said no government was willing to hold local government elections; if they were held, powers were not delegated to the grassroots.

“At this time, the issue is not about votes but about people's survival. The system of civic governments in Pakistan has been destroyed.

“No government wants to hold local government elections. When they do, they do not give them powers,” Jamaat-e-Islami Ameer Hafiz Naeem-ur-Rehman said.

If people get honest leadership, the issues can be resolved. There is no one to give direction and employment opportunities to the youth, the JI chief added.
